The Civic
You'll find The Civic on the corner of Queen Street and Wellesley Street. The Civic is a 2,378 seat theatre
The first purpose-built cinema for 'talkies' in the country, The Civic is a much-loved Auckland landmark and entertainment venue. Built in 1929, The Civic is an outstanding example of the ‘atmospheric cinema’ architecture style, with a unique soft-top ceiling design that floats above the auditorium, allowing the famed stars and clouds effect that is a recreation of the Southern Hemisphere night sky.
